BUCKiT #65-Robert Greene: 5 Time Best Selling Author on Attaining Mastery | Part 2 This is Part two of my interview with Robert Greene a best selling author and speaker most known for his ground breaking and life changing books on strategy, power, and seduction. He has written 5 international bestsellers - The 48 Laws of Power, The Art of Seduction, The 33 Strategies of War, The 50th Law, and Mastery as well as his new book, The Laws of Human Nature.

Greene’s books are hailed by everyone from business leaders, to historians, to the biggest musicians in the industry, including Jay-Z, Drake, and 50 Cent.

Robert Greene says, “I want to get under your skin and change the way you look at the world”.

In the second part of my interview with this brilliant writer, we go deeper into how we all have the potential to attain MASTERY!
